Resume Scoring Rubric
|
| 4 | 3 | 2 | 1 |
TOTAL |
| Format/ | The resume consistently follows formatting guidelines for length, layout, spacing, and alignment. Format and layout make the resume exceptionally attractive, drawing attention to the content, and enhancing readability. | Formatting guidelines for length, layout, spacing, and/or alignment are almost always followed. 1-2 problems in format and layout, but readability and attractiveness are not affected. | Formatting is repeatedly inconsistent in length, layout, spacing, and/or alignment, reducing readability and attractiveness. | Formatting guidelines for length, layout, spacing, and/or alignment are not followed, making the resume unattractive or hard to read. |
|
| Style | The fonts are consistent and easy to read. Font size varies appropriately for headings and text. Use of font styles (italic, bold, underline) is used consistently and improves readability. | The fonts are consistent and easy to read. Font size varies appropriately for headings and text. | Fonts are not used consistently, varying in style and size and making the text difficult to read. | No consistency in fonts. A wide variety of fonts, styles and point sizes was used. |
|
| Content | The resume includes all necessary items (headings) and follows guidelines consistently (e.g. objective, action verbs, dates,, places). Relevant education and experience substantiate position sought and are presented in reverse chronological order. | Almost all necessary items are included and guidelines are followed for the most part. 1-2 errors in presentation of the content (e.g. objective, dates/places, action verbs, use of reverse chronological order). | Several necessary content items are missing or there are several errors in presentation (e.g. objective, dates, places, actions verbs or use of reverse chronological order). | Presentation of content contains many errors or omissions, e.g. in the use of chronological order, action verbs, objective, dates, places, etc. |
|
| Grammar/ | The resume uses accurate English grammar and vocabulary (word forms, word choice). Action verbs are consistently used in past tense. | There are 1-3 errors in the use of English grammar and vocabulary (word forms, word choice). Action verbs are almost always used in past tense. | There are 4-5 errors in English grammar and vocabulary (word forms, word choice). Action verbs are often not used in past tense. | There are more than 5 errors in English grammar and vocabulary (word forms, word choice). Action verbs are usually not used in past tense. |
|
| Mechanics (Spelling, Punctuation/ | There are no errors in spelling, punctuation, or capitalization in the resume. | There are 1-3 errors in spelling, punctuation, or capitalization in the resume. | There are 4-5 errors in spelling, punctuation, or capitalization in the resume. | There are more than 5 errors in spelling, punctuation, capitalization in the resume. |
